Beauty Brands Blast EU to End ‘Back Door’ Animal Testing in Open Letter via Cosmetics Business

Fronted by Cruelty Free Europe and PETA, as well as 450 other brands, the letter calls for the EU Cosmetics Regulation to uphold animal testing bans

Beauty brands have blasted the EU in an open letter calling for an end to ‘back door’ animal testing.

Helmed by Cruelty Free Europe and PETA, The Body Shop, Dove and Simple are among the 450 brands to back the letter.
